In 1937, Virginia Lee Vaughan entered the world in Goldsboro, Wayne, North Carolina, USA, born to James Lloyd Vaughan And Alma Otelia Belcher. In 1940, Virginia Lee Vaughan resided in Petersburg, Independent Cities, Virginia, USA. In 1950, Virginia Lee Vaughan resided in Petersburg, Independent Cities, Virginia, USA. Virginia Lee Vaughan married Daniel Alexander Majkowski, Vincent Albert Vidal. Virginia Lee Vaughan passed away in 1995 in Petersburg, Independent Cities, Virginia, USA.
